Royal Hotel South Beach is a lodging, located at 763 Pennsylvania Ave, Miami Beach, FL 33139, USA. They can be contacted via phone at +1 305-673-9009, visit their website www.royalsouthbeach.com for more detailed information.

  • Frank Juhasz
    18 February 2017

    It's all about location.
    This classic Deco hotel is two blocks from Lummus Park and the beach, all the action on Ocean Ave and plenty of the best Local cafes and restaurants. The staff are very attentive and helpful . Beach chairs, umbrellas and towels are available free from the desk. That said it is what would be called a 2 star hotel in Europe- basic clean place to sleep. Fair warning there IS street noise here- late into the night.
